This week a contestant by the name of Sharon Mathai sang her version of Rumor has it. There was a bit of a twist on the song. The main difference was how the song was cut. On air they only showed the fast paced sections of the song. This of course is also the catchy part of the song and therefore has been stuck in my mind ever since. The original version of Rumor has it was done by Adele on her album “Adele 21” that was released in 2011.
